PTA Christmas Fair another great success!


Many thanks to everyone who came along to support the Christmas  Fair. A highlight for many of the younger children this year was a  visit from Santa!
We are so grateful to the fabulous parent volunteers,  family friends and Priory College pupils who helped to set up earlier today, man  a stall and / or help to tidy up extremely well afterwards. It was so  encouraging to see a number of new faces on the PTA team today along with the  familiar HPS faces too. It simply made everything so much easier!
A special  mention to Kellie Shimmin and volunteers who have been working really hard to  prepare for the Fair over a number of weeks. Their teamwork ensured everything  ran smoothly and hopefully allowed parents and grandparents to relax while the  boys and girls had great fun. Thanks also to Kellie Grant for co-ordinating the  great raffle prizes too which were generously donated by local businesses and  families closely connected to HPS . 

**********************A FANTASTIC TOTAL OF OVER £2400 WAS RAISED !**************************
Once again thank you so much for all your help and supporting the Fair today. There certainly was plenty of Christmas cheer at HPS!

Shared Education Day for P3!

All the P3 boys and girls in Holywood Primary travelled today to the Queens Leisure Complex in Holywood to meet for the first time with all the P3 pupils at Glencraig Integrated Primary for what promised to be a fun filled day! Both schools were excited and enthusiastic about their first meeting as part of their Shared Education Partnership.

The P3 pupils experienced lots of icebreaker games to get to know each other followed by lots of activities to keep both the pupils, staff and parent helpers entertained. The pupils from both schools worked together in groups to complete arts and craft activities and parachute games before all coming together to do lots of dancing during our energetic Zumba class! Mr Atcheson stole the show with his own rendition of the Cha Cha Slide!

All the pupils finished by singing a lovely song all about friendship before waving goodbye! All the P3 pupils I’m sure will be looking forward to meeting up with their new friends from Glencraig Integrated Primary School very soon! :)
